What to Look for Before Buying the Best Frying Pan Company

Choosing the right frying pan goes beyond just picking a brand; its about matching the pans characteristics to your cooking style, cooktop, and budget. Here are the key factors to consider to ensure you make a wise investment.

Find Your Need - Compatibility and use case considerations

First, think about what you cook most often. Are you constantly searing steaks at high heat? A cast iron or carbon steel pan is ideal. Do you prefer delicate foods like eggs and fish? A non-stick pan will make your life much easier. Also, check your cooktop. If you have an induction stove, you need a pan with a magnetic base—cast iron and many stainless steel pans work, but pure aluminum or copper pans wont unless they have a bonded induction plate.

Budget - Setting realistic price expectations

Frying pans come in a vast price range. You can get a reliable Lodge cast iron skillet for under $30, while a premium, artisan-made pan from a company like Field Company can cost over $150. Non-stick pans also vary, from budget-friendly options under $25 to high-end models that cost over $100. Set a realistic budget, but remember that a higher price often correlates with better materials, durability, and performance. Think of it as an investment; a good pan can last for years, or even a lifetime.

Key Features - Most important technical specifications

Pay attention to the details. For non-stick pans, look for coatings that are PFOA and PFAS-free for health and safety. For cast iron, consider if you prefer a smoother, machined surface or a traditional pebbled one. Handle design is also crucial—is it ergonomic? Does it stay cool on the stovetop? Is it oven-safe? The pans weight and balance will affect how comfortable it is to use daily. Finally, features like included lids or helper handles can add significant value and versatility.

Quality & Durability - What to look for in construction

A pans material is the primary determinant of its durability. Cast iron is famously rugged and can last for generations if cared for properly. Stainless steel is also incredibly durable and resistant to rust and warping. Non-stick pans have a more limited lifespan, as the coating will eventually wear down. Look for pans with a thick, heavy-gauge construction, as they are less likely to warp and will distribute heat more evenly. A solid connection between the handle and the pan body is also a sign of quality construction.

Brand Reputation - Importance of established manufacturers

A companys reputation is built on years of customer satisfaction and product performance. Established brands like Lodge have a long history of producing reliable cookware. Newer, premium brands like Field Company build their reputation on quality craftsmanship and customer service. Reading reviews and checking for warranties can give you insight into a companys commitment to its products. A reputable brand is more likely to stand behind its product if you encounter any issues.

Portability/Size - Considerations for space and storage

Consider the size of the pan you need. An 8-inch skillet is perfect for one or two eggs, while a 12-inch pan is necessary for family-sized meals. Think about your storage space. A large, deep skillet with a long handle takes up more room than a compact 8-inch pan. If youre short on space, a versatile 10-inch skillet might be the best all-around choice. Also, consider the weight—if you have difficulty lifting heavy objects, a lighter cast iron pan or an aluminum non-stick pan will be a better fit.

What Is the Best Way to Choose frying pan company?

Choosing the right frying pan company involves a thoughtful process that aligns your cooking needs with the right product. Heres a step-by-step guide to help you select the best option.

  1. Assess Your Primary Cooking Style: Start by identifying the foods you cook most frequently. If youre all about high-heat searing for steaks and burgers, a cast iron specialist like Lodge or Field Company is your best bet. If your daily routine involves eggs, pancakes, and delicate fish, a non-stick brand like THE COOKS COMPANY or SENSARTE will prevent sticking and make cleanup a breeze.

  2. Match the Material to Your Maintenance Level: Be honest about how much care youre willing to put in. Cast iron requires seasoning and careful cleaning to maintain its non-stick properties but rewards you with unparalleled longevity. Non-stick is low-maintenance (no seasoning, easy cleaning) but requires gentle handling (no metal utensils) and will need to be replaced eventually. Stainless steel is durable and versatile but can be prone to sticking if not used correctly.

  3. Set Your Budget and Look for Value: Determine what you are comfortable spending. You dont need the most expensive pan to get great results. A brand like Lodge offers incredible value, providing workhorse performance for a minimal investment. If you have more to spend, brands like Field Company offer aesthetic and ergonomic refinements. For non-stick, look for value in sets or in brands that offer non-toxic coatings and oven safety at a reasonable price.

  4. Check for Essential Features: Dont overlook the details. Ensure the pan is compatible with your stovetop (especially induction). Check the handle material and whether its oven-safe to the temperatures you typically use. A comfortable, stay-cool handle is a must for stovetop cooking. A helper handle on a larger, heavier pan is a huge plus for safety and maneuverability.

  5. Avoid Common Mistakes: A common mistake is buying a full set when you only need one or two good pans. Start with one versatile skillet (a 10 or 12-inch) and build from there. Another mistake is prioritizing looks over function. A beautiful pan is nice, but its useless if it heats unevenly or is uncomfortable to use. Finally, dont fall for marketing hype. Focus on the core materials, construction, and user reviews rather than buzzwords.

How do I maintain my frying pan company?

Maintenance depends on the material. For cast iron, avoid soap for the first few months, clean with hot water and a scraper or brush, dry it thoroughly on the stove, and wipe a thin layer of cooking oil inside while its still warm. For non-stick pans, always hand wash with a soft sponge, avoid metal utensils, and avoid extreme temperature changes to protect the coating.

How long do frying pan company typically last?

A well-maintained cast iron skillet from a company like Lodge or Field Company can last for multiple generations—literally 100 years or more. A good quality non-stick frying pan, with proper care, will typically last between 3 to 5 years before the coating starts to degrade. Heavy-duty stainless steel pans can also last a lifetime, though they may show cosmetic wear.
